I seem to be having a problem with my TP600. Each time during boot-up it doesn't see neither hard drive, nor cd-rom, only floppy drive. I thought this to be a fatal problem, but suddenly tried 'initialize'. It worked!
And it works. Though now I have to 'initialize' it each time before the actual boot. Then everything seems to be working. Even in the case of reboot I have to do the same thing.
I have measured the voltage of my BIOS battery, that's not the case, it's 3V, nominal voltage.
Maybe somebody had such a problem before?
